Founded in 1974, Swords to Plowshares is a community-based not-for-profit organization that provides counseling and case management, employment and training, housing, and legal assistance to veterans in the San Francisco Bay Area. We promote and protect the rights of veterans through advocacy, public education, and partnerships with local, state, and national entities. Believing that war causes wounds and suffering that last beyond the battlefield, our mission is to support veterans as they navigate the challenges of post-military life, and to prevent and end veteran homelessness through wrap-around care and informed advocacy.

Summary:

The Employment Specialist-II recruits, enrolls and provided job placement assistance to each veteran. The Employment Specialist-II provides supportive services, develops recruitment and implementation plans, and performs community and some employment outreach throughout the San Francisco and East Bay Area. The Employment Specialist-II provides assessments, case management, information and referral, and job counseling to assist veterans reintegrating into the civilian workforce. Employment Specialists-II coordinates with employers for job placement and/or occupational training programs in accordance with contract goals.

Employment Specialist-II will host employer spotlights and assist with workshops, maintain relationships with community-based organizations, employers, assist Program Managers with special projects.

Responsibilities:

Assess and counsel veterans for job readiness

Develop Individual Employment Plans (IEP’s) with veteran clients to assess barriers to employment, and identify individual veteran client service needs

Determine client eligibility for federal/state employment and training programs

Maintain veteran participant caseload and make necessary referrals to additional services as appropriate, including counseling on mental health issues, legal advocacy, job readiness workshops, and pre‑employment training

Provides job placement assistance including resume development, job search, interview techniques, host employer spotlights and aid with weekly workshops

Provide support services, including liaison or linkages with advocacy programs for VA benefits and other entitlements, personal counseling services, and community programs for the homeless and/or unemployed

Maintain concise and up‑to‑date client files, including required documentation and weekly case/progress notes, thorough and accurate completion and execution of paperwork in a timely manner

Perform any other employment related tasks as identified and delegated by the Employment Director, Program Manager, and Program Coordinator
